Janus kinase (jak) inhibitors are a group of medicines that help block immune system signals in the body that can lead to swelling (inflammation) and pain in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, ulcerative colitis, and psoriatic arthritis. A jak inhibitor interferes with signals in the body that are thought to cause inflammation This, in turn, reduces the inflammation that fuels diseases like eczema, psoriatic arthritis, and vitiligo. Janus kinases (jaks) are cytokine receptors that facilitate intracellular signaling and modulate gene expression. After decades of no new treatments, janus kinase (jak) inhibitors have renewed hope for people with moderate to severe alopecia areata Jak inhibitors are immunomodulatory drugs They target the immune system pathway that is overactive in alopecia areata. What is a jak2 mutation The janus kinase 2 (jak2) gene directs cells to make the jak2 protein, which stimulates cell growth and division. Since members of the type i and type ii cytokine receptor families possess no catalytic kinase activity, they rely on the jak family of tyrosine kinases to phosphorylate and activate downstream proteins involved in their signal transduction pathways.
